Iii. Rated power of PCB transformer

Ike akara nke transformer bụ oke ike nke ngwaọrụ nwere ike ijikwa n’okpuru ibu. In extremely high power transformers, heat is maintained to acceptable levels using coolants such as liquids and pressurized airflow. Na PCB, ọkwa adịghị elu dị ka ọ dị na igwe ọkụ ọkụ dị oke elu, mana ọkwa ọkụ a nwere ike bụrụ ihe dị oke mkpa ma ngwaọrụ enwere ike ịrụ ọrụ na PCB.

Ise, opekata mpe na opekata mpe ọrụ PCB transformer

The maximum operating frequency of a PCB transformer – usually measured in Hertz – defines the maximum frequency at which the transformer can operate safely and obtain the desired output parameters.

A na -agbakwụnye nkọwapụta opekata mpe ọrụ na PCB transformer. Operating the transformer at low frequencies can result in unexpected results and may cause actual damage to the components.

Opekempe na kacha okpomọkụ nke PCB transformer

Akụkụ eletrọniki ọ bụla nwere opekempe okpomọkụ na -arụ ọrụ. Na PCB transformers, uru a nwere ike ịdị mkpa n’ihi na ntụgharị ọkụ etinyere na akụrụngwa ụlọ ọrụ ma ọ bụ akụrụngwa ndị ọzọ nwere ike rụọ ọrụ nso ma ọ bụ n’okpuru obere okpomọkụ. N’okpuru opekempe okpomọkụ ọrụ, enweghị ike ikwe nkwa arụmọrụ transformer.

Ihe ntụgharị ọkụ niile na -ewepụta oke ọkụ, yana oke okpomọkụ nke PCB transformer na -amachi ọnọdụ kacha ekpo ọkụ nke enwere ike ịrụ ọrụ na transformer. Ịgafe uru a nwere ike bute ọdịda, mmebi sekit na nsogbu ndị ọzọ. N’ihi na ndị na -agbanwe PCB enweghị mmiri jụrụ oyi ma ọ bụ ụzọ jụrụ oyi ndị ọzọ siri ike, ndị injinia ga -eburu n’uche oke okpomọkụ arụ ọrụ.
